Do you remember when the Detroit Pistons lost Game 4 of their 2007 Eastern Conference Finals match-up against the Cleveland Cavaliers, and Rasheed Wallace shot 4-10 for the game, going 0-4 from the 3-point line, missing a free throw to boot, as the Cavs came back in the 4th quarter to win it, tying the series at two games apiece, followed by Sheed whipping his sweaty jersey at the wall in the tunnel, only to hold on a little too long, making the jersey fly backwards, and right onto the head and face of a Piston rookie Will Blalock?
